Hiberians F.C. terminates contract with Justin Haber after court decision

Thursday, 9 October 2025, 19:18 Last update: about 9 months ago

Hiberians F.C. has terminated its contract with goalkeeper Justin Haber.

The former national team goalkeeper and former Labour councillor was found guilty of subjecting a minor under the age of fifteen to acts or behaviour of a sexual nature.

Haber was sentenced to two years imprisonment, suspended for four years. He was also fined €7,000 and a three-year restraining order was issued in favour of the victim.

"This is to confirm that the agreement between the club and player Justin Haber has been terminated. No further comment will be made at this time," the club said in a statement on social media.
